Director, Translational Science (Neurology)

Eisai
Posted 2 weeks ago
🇺🇸United States🏢Hybrid💰$204.3K–$268.2K📁Writing & Content Creation
Is this job info correct?

At Eisai, satisfying unmet medical needs and increasing the benefits healthcare provides to patients, their families, and caregivers is Eisai’s human health care (hhc) mission. We’re a growing pharmaceutical company that is breaking through in neurology and oncology, with a strong emphasis on research and development. Our history includes the development of many innovative medicines, notably the discovery of the world's most widely-used treatment for Alzheimer’s disease. As we continue to expand, we are seeking highly-motivated individuals who want to work in a fast-paced environment and make a difference. If this is your profile, we want to hear from you. Director, Translational Science (Neurology) Position Summary The Director of Translational Science is a scientifically driven leader who contributes to and drives the execution of integrated translational strategies across neurology programs spanning discovery through early clinical development. This role focuses on enabling data-driven decision-making by linking disease biology, biomarkers, and clinical outcomes. This position is designed to complement existing expertise in Alzheimer’s disease by bringing deep knowledge in non-Alzheimer’s neurodegenerative disorders, including Parkinson’s disease, Lewy body dementia, primary tauopathies, and sleep-related neurobiology. The successful candidate will combine strong scientific insight with hands-on engagement in biomarker strategy, data interpretation, and cross-functional collaboration. Key Responsibilities Translational Strategy & Execution Contribute to and drive execution of translational strategies across neurology programs Design and implement multi-modal biomarker approaches (e.g., biofluid, imaging, digital biomarkers) Help define data-driven decision frameworks in collaboration with translational and clinical leadership Translate emerging disease biology into testable clinical hypotheses and biomarker strategies Clinical & Scientific Integration Lead translational components of programs from study design through data analysis and interpretation Interpret and contextualize biomarker and clinical data to inform program decisions and development strategy Partner with Clinical, Clinical Pharmacology, and Biostatistics teams to support trial design, dose strategy, and endpoint selection Bridge preclinical findings and clinical development through mechanistic and disease-relevant insights Biomarker Development & Data Insights Contribute to development and implementation of biomarker strategies supporting clinical trials Work closely with internal teams and external partners to ensure robust biomarker performance and data quality Collaborate with data scientists to integrate datasets and deliver actionable insights from complex, multimodal data Collaboration & Scientific Leadership Serve as a key translational representative on cross-functional program teams Influence program direction through scientific insight and data-driven recommendations Act as a scientific thought partner within the team and contribute to capability building Present findings internally and externally; contribute to scientific publications and congress presentations May mentor junior scientists or contribute to development of team expertise Innovation & External Engagement Engage with academic and industry experts to stay at the forefront of emerging science in neurodegenerative diseases Apply innovative approaches (e.g., omics, AI/ML, digital biomarkers) to better understand disease heterogeneity and progression Integrate multimodal data to refine disease models, patient stratification approaches, and biomarker strategies Regulatory Contributions Contribute to translational aspects of regulatory documents and submissions (e.g., protocols, investigator brochures, briefing materials) Partner with senior leaders to support Health Authority interactions and strategy Support development of companion diagnostic and biomarker qualification strategies Qualifications PhD, MD, or equivalent in Neuroscience, Pharmacology, Molecular Biology, or related field ~8–10 years of relevant experience in pharmaceutical/biotechnology drug development Strong expertise in translational science and biomarker development Demonstrated experience supporting translational aspects of clinical programs Hands-on experience with biomarkers (fluid, imaging, and/or digital) Preferred Scientific Expertise Deep expertise in one or more non-Alzheimer’s neurodegenerative diseases, including: Parkinson’s disease Lewy body dementia Primary tauopathies (e.g., PSP, CBD) Experience with disease-relevant biomarkers (e.g., α-synuclein, tau, sleep/circadian measures) strongly preferred Familiarity with clinical endpoints and disease progression in relevant indications Core Capabilities Strong ability to interpret complex biological and clinical data and translate into actionable insights Proven ability to collaborate and influence within cross-functional teams Scientific curiosity, creativity, and a problem-solving mindset Excellent communication skills and ability to distill complex concepts for diverse audiences Why Join Us? You will join a collaborative and innovative translational science team focused on advancing the next generation of therapies for neurodegenerative diseases. This role offers the opportunity to shape translational strategy, deepen understanding of complex disease biology, and contribute meaningfully to improving patient outcomes.
